Discovery :: Discovery (n.) A making known; revelation; disclosure; as, a bankrupt is bound to make a full discovery of his assets..
Bankrupt :: Bankrupt (n.) A person who, in accordance with the terms of a law relating to bankruptcy, has been judicially declared to be unable to meet his liabilities..
Bankruptcy :: Bankruptcy (n.) The state of being actually or legally bankrupt.
Bankruptcy :: Bankruptcy (n.) The act or process of becoming a bankrupt.
Bankrupt :: Bankrupt (a.) Destitute of, or wholly wanting (something once possessed, or something one should possess)..
Bankrupt :: Bankrupt (n.) A trader who becomes unable to pay his debts; an insolvent trader; popularly, any person who is unable to pay his debts; an insolvent person..
